Output de90b5667c6e27814ea9ecdee8ee18f963983fb73de0fe56bcddf85816857e69:0

value
642650
script pubkey
OP_0 OP_PUSHBYTES_32 dc5b5942e1f8d4d28600f6ba98b2e0673e48f5c6d4549e00872aad7b9756b156
address
bc1qm3d4jshplr2d9psq76af3vhqvuly3awx632fuqy892khh96kk9tquayqta
transaction
de90b5667c6e27814ea9ecdee8ee18f963983fb73de0fe56bcddf85816857e69
spent
true